Congratulations to the winners of the Nobel Prize in Physiology or Medicine 2025
The Nobel Prize in Physiology or Medicine 2025 was awarded to Dr. Mary E. Brunkow, Dr. Fred Ramsdell, and Dr. Shimon Sakaguchi for their discoveries concerning peripheral immune tolerance. BCCHR's Dr. Megan Levings reflects on the significance of this area of research and how these immune cells could develop treatments for numerous diseases such as type 1 diabetes, multiple sclerosis, organ rejection, and more.
